C++ Quantitative Developer - Hedge Fund

£150000 - £250000 per annum + with Bonus and perks



Salary/ Package - 150k - 250k base salary depending on experience

Bonus - Highly competitive results-based bonus

Working model - Hybrid

Location - West London

A leading Technology-driven Hedge Fund in London is seeking a highly motivated and talented Quantitative Developer with C++ and Python experience to join their team. Their company uses mathematical and statistical techniques to generate investment strategies and is looking for a candidate who can bring their technical skills and passion for finance to the table.


  • Design, develop, and maintain low-latency trading infrastructure using C++ and Python.
  • Implement mathematical models and algorithms to support investment strategies.
  • Collaborate with the trading and research teams to integrate trading strategies into the production environment.
  • Monitor the performance of the trading systems and identify areas for improvement.
  • Write clean, maintainable, and scalable code.
  • Participate in code reviews and contribute to the development of best practices.


  • Bachelor's or Master's degree in Computer Science, Mathematics, Physics, or a related field.
  • 3+ years of experience in C++ software development.
  • Strong experience in Python programming.
  • Familiarity with mathematical and statistical techniques.
  • Knowledge of financial markets and instruments.
  • Excellent problem-solving skills.
  • Ability to work in a fast-paced and dynamic environment.
  • Strong communication skills and the ability to work in a team.

This is a unique opportunity to join a dynamic and growing company in the heart of London's financial district. If you are passionate about finance and technology and have a proven track record of delivering high-quality software, we want to hear from you.

McGregor Boyall is an equal opportunity employer and do not discriminate on any grounds.


To stay safe in your job search we recommend that you visit SAFERjobs, a non-profit, joint industry and law enforcement organisation working to combat job scams. Visit the SAFERjobs website for information on common scams and to get free, expert advice for a safer job search.

  • C++ Developer
    £130000 - £250000 per annum + Bonus + Benefits

    Job Title: Software Developer - Trading and Research Platform - Quantitative Investment Manager

    About the Company: my client is a leading quantitative and systematic investment manager with a global market presence across the largest liquid electronic venues in Europe, Asia-Pacific, and North America. The company is technology-driven and implements a scientific approach to financial investment by combining data, research, technology, and trading expertise to achieve high-quality returns for investors.

    Job Description: As a key member of the development team, you will be responsible for building and enhancing vital components of the trading and research platform. Your role will have the potential to touch many aspects of electronic and algorithmic trading, backtesting, and data management systems. You will work with traders and quants to roll-out, support and run strategies. In addition, you will be responsible for building and supporting new quantitative trading framework software, designing clean architecture and leveraging state of the art tools and components, and bringing new ideas and experimenting with new technologies.


    • 4+ years of professional experience as a software developer
    • Expert in C++ programming language
    • Proficient in Python
    • Ability to maintain standards in code quality and good development practices
    • Extensive knowledge of real-time systems, high performance computing and quantitative applications
    • Prior experience within either a hedge fund, eTrading team, algo trading team or market maker highly desired

    If you are passionate about working with cutting-edge technologies, building and enhancing complex systems, and collaborating with a talented and dynamic team of professionals, this is an excellent opportunity to take your career to the next level. We are looking for the absolute best developers in the market and can pay to reflect this.

    McGregor Boyall is an equal opportunity employer and do not discriminate on any grounds.

  • SQL Server Developer - T-SQL, ETL, Teradata

    SQL Server Developer required to help deliver a project with an Edinburgh-based Financial Services client. You will work as part of the SQL Server development team on the end to end development of new and existing data feeds, data processes, data layers and reporting. You will have most of the following:

    • Querying SQL Server databases (preferred), or any other relational databases (e.g. TeraData, Oracle etc)
    • SQL Server development covering development of databases, stored procedures and performance tuning
    • Loading and transforming data
    • Working with large and complex datasets
    • Developing reports, dashboards and visualisations using Power BI or Tableau
    • Knowledge of relational database concepts and methodologies
    • Experience of agile scrum methodology

    This role is inside IR35 and offers hybrid working.

    McGregor Boyall is acting as an Employment Business in relation to this vacancy.

  • eRates Trading BAPM
    £750 - £850 per day

    eRates Trading BAPM

    Contract Role

    Umbrella Day Rate - £750 - £850/day (Inside IR35)

    London – Hybrid Working (3 days a week in office)

    Looking for a BAPM to work on an eRates electronic trading platform which underpins the electronic rates activity including pricing, hedging and execution.

    Candidates should have:

    • Experience as a business analyst / project manager in a financial services organisation
    • Strong knowledge of fixed income instruments, and associated trading workflows: Government Bonds, Interest Swaps, Repos, Futures and options
    • Extensive understanding of electronic trading venues and associated dataflows i.e., market, static and trade data.
    • Experience of working with the ION Trading
    • Excellent communication skills in English, spoken and written.
    • Active interest in design of system architecture

    McGregor Boyall is an equal opportunity employer and do not discriminate on any grounds.